Find the range for the set of data.

Mathematics
2 answers:
den301095 [7]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

66

Step-by-step explanation:

put them in order from least to greatest.

51, 51, 56, 58, 68, 72, 90, 101, 101, 111, 114, 115, 117

Subtract the minimum data value from the maximum data value to find the data range. In this case, the data range is...

117-51=

66

You have a wire that is 29 cm long. you wish to cut it into two pieces. one piece will be bent into the shape of a square. the o
Nostrana [21]
C = circumference of circle
p = perimeter of square
c + p = 29
p = 29 - c

side of square = (29 - c)/4
radius of circle = c/(2pi)

a = side^2 + (pi)r^2

a = ((29 - c)/4)^2 + pi * (c/(2pi))^2

a = (1/16)(841 - 58c + c^2) + (c^2/(4pi^2)) * pi

a = 52.5625 - 3.625c + c^2/16 + c^2/(4pi)

Since the 2nd degree term has a positive coefficient is positive, this has a graph that is a parabola opening up. It has a minimum value.

We take the derivative of the area expression and set equal to zero to find the minimum circumference.

da/dc = -3.625 + c/8 + (c/(2pi)) = 0

c = 12.76

Answer: 12.76 cm
